The WARNING sign denotes a hazard. It calls attention to a procedure, practice or the like,
which, if not correctly performed or adhered to, could result in injury or loss of life. Do not
proceed beyond a WARNING sign until the indicated conditions are fully understood and
met.
Optical power levels above 100 mW applied to single mode connectors can easily damage
the connector if it is not perfectly clean. Also, scratched or poorly cleaned connectors can
destroy optical connectors mechanically. Always make sure that your optical connectors are
properly cleaned and unscratched before connection. Refer to chapter "Cleaning
Information" on page 77 on appropriate procedures for connector cleaning and inspection.

Initial Inspection

Inspect the shipping container for damage. If there is damage to the container or
cushioning, keep them until you have checked the contents of the shipment for
completeness and verified the instrument both mechanically and electrically.
The Performance Tests give procedures for checking the operation of the instrument. If the
contents are incomplete, mechanical damage or defect is apparent, or if an instrument does
not pass the operator's checks, notify the nearest Agilent Technologies Sales/Service
Office.
